A pair of newer 4 x 12, loaded with Celestion G12-T75 speakers. While not the Vintage 30s, I personally find the T75s a lot more articulate with considerably more transient retention than their classic counterparts which are supposed to be 'warmer'. It all depends on what kind of sound your after.
Both cabs have original castors and the 1960A sits on top of the 1960B to make the classic Marshall stack.
Neither cabs have been gigged and are in really nice condition.

Each cab is rated at 300 Watts RMS and has an impedance of 16Ω. The input panel on the rear of each cab, allows for a 'stereo' connection which will be 2 x 8Ω. When both cabs are wired into one amp, the combined impedance is 8Ω. Hope that makes sense but if it doesn't just ask me. 🙂
